New Chevrolet Cruze 2023 versions
The current second generation Cruze was introduced in 2015, a year later the hatchback also made up the company of the sedan. In 2018, the car underwent restyling, after which it left North America, Korea and China. The model is still sold in selected markets. To stir up interest in the Cruze, Chevrolet decided to release two new modifications – Midnight for a sedan and a sporty RS for a hatchback car.
In the US, the RS version of the model was available initially, but for South America it was an unexpected novelty. The version intended for Argentina and Brazil is almost an exact copy of the modification for the native market. Among the differences are a black-painted grille with a mesh pattern and a different form of fog lamps. The brand logo is now also black. The side mirror housings, roof and spoiler are also painted black.
The overall style is continued in the interior. The black interior is “decorated” with red contrast stitching. The list of equipment includes a multimedia system with an 8.0 display, climate control, cruise control, rain and light sensors.

The appearance of the RS prefix in the name of the model did not affect its characteristics in any way. The hatchback, as before, is driven by a turbocharged 1.4-liter engine that produces 153 hp. The motor is paired with a six-speed automatic transmission. Drive – front.
The sedan performed by Midnight is modified by analogy – the chrome decor was noticed in black. Buyers will be able to choose between three body colors – black, gray and dark blue. The same equipment is available for the model as for the RS version. The only difference is the diagonal of the display. The sedan has a 7-inch.
